The EMP can be used to temporarily disable the Killer’s BioPods or remove the Slipstream effect from other Survivors.Įnd Transmission also brings two extraterrestrial outfits for The Singularity and Gabriel. Gabriel is dexterous and uses a tool called the EMP, randomly located around a Map when facing The Singularity. With the chapter comes a new Survivor, Gabriel Soma, a technician who has survived The Singularity so far, having avoided the terrible fate of his crewmates. You will need to rethink your strategies, as The Singularity’s power can turn cooperation on its head. ![]() A fully Slipstreamed Survivor will spread the effect to other nearby Survivors. The Slipstream effect causes The Singularity to be able to materialize behind a Survivor, and immediately begin chase. Placeable on vertical surfaces, The Singularity can transfer its consciousness to the BioPods to spy on Survivors and attempt to Slipstream them to reform itself at their location. This monstrous being restructured of organic matter and machine parts seeks to assimilate all organic life and become the perfect life form.Īn enlightened AI corrupted by alien technology, The Singularity can spy on Survivors anywhere on the map, has a high intellect, and can spread its presence through restructured organic matter with the help of its BioPods.
